What I Have Learned

  • Don’t skip the softening step for cream cheese—lumpy filling is the most common mistake. Let it sit on the counter for 30 minutes before you start beating.
  • Fold, don’t stir, when combining the whipped cream with the cream cheese mixture. Stirring deflates all those air bubbles and results in a denser, heavier cheesecake.
  • Use a springform pan lined with parchment paper on the bottom—it prevents leaks and makes removing the cheesecake clean and easy.

Variations

  • Mini No-Bake Oreo Cheesecakes: Layer the crust and filling in individual mason jars or dessert cups for easy, elegant single servings.
  • Cookies and Cream Swirl: Add a chocolate ganache layer in the middle or create a marbled effect by swirling melted chocolate through the filling before chilling.
  • Peanut Butter Oreo Cheesecake: Mix one-half cup of creamy peanut butter into the cream cheese filling for a classic flavor combination that’s absolutely addictive.

Instructions

  1. 1

    Make the Crust

    Combine Oreo crumbs and melted butter in a bowl, mixing until the texture resembles wet sand. Press firmly into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an. Refrigerate while you prepare the filling.

  2. 2

    Beat the Cream Cheese

    Using an electric mixer, beat softened cream cheese with sugar and vanilla extract for 2-3 minutes until smooth and fluffy. Scrape down the bowl frequently to avoid lumps.

  3. 3

    Whip the Cream

    In a separate bowl, whip heavy cream to stiff peaks using clean beaters. This takes about 3-4 minutes.

  4. 4

    Fold Together

    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ture in two additions, being careful not to deflate the cream. Then fold in the crushed Oreos.

  5. 5

    Assemble

    Pour the filling over the crust and smooth the top with a spatula.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or overnight for best results.

  6. 6

    Garnish and Serve

    Top with whole Oreos and dollops of whipped cream just before serving. Run a warm knife around the edges and remove the springform ring carefully.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this cheesecake ahead of time?

Absolutely! This cheesecake is actually better when made a day or two in advance. The flavors meld together beautifully, and it stays perfectly chilled in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Just cover it loosely with plastic wrap.

Can I freeze a no-bake Oreo cheesecake?

Yes, you can freeze it for up to 2 months. Wrap it well in plastic wrap and then foil before freezing.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before serving. The texture remains creamy and delicious.

What if my cream cheese is too cold?

Cold cream cheese will be lumpy and difficult to mix. Always let it sit on the counter for 30 minutes before beating. You can also cut it into smaller chunks to speed up softening.
